How to change power steering fluid. with the engine turned off, use the turkey baster to draw out old power steering fluid until the reservoir is as empty as possible. refill the reservoir with new fluid, replace reservoir cap and remove any rags or paper towels from engine area. start engine and turn steering wheel back and forth to right and.

How to change power steering fluid the easiest way to change psf is to suck it out of the reservoir with a dedicated turkey baster. if you have lots of other internal combustion engine equipment — like a lawn mower, snow blower, generator, etc. — consider investing in a fluid change syringe or inexpensive fluid transfer pump . And that will circulate the fluid when you’re done, shut off the engine, repeat this fluid change process at least three times, or until the fluid is clean and free of contaminants. some vehicles come with red power steering fluid. the red dye has a tendency to stay in the system. so, if after 3 to 5 changes, you still see it in the fluid.
